活动介绍
file-type

逍遥西游加密解密教程与工具使用指南

版权申诉

ZIP文件

167.39MB | 更新于2024-11-16 | 62 浏览量 | 0 下载量 举报 收藏
download 限时特惠:#14.90
知识点一:APK包的反编译方法 逍遥西游客户端加密解密视屏教程首先介绍了如何使用反编译工具来反编译APK包。APK包是Android平台上的应用程序安装包,它实际上是一个压缩包,其中包含了应用程序的所有文件。反编译APK包是将APK文件解压,使得开发者能够查看到其中的资源文件和代码,这对于分析应用程序的行为和逻辑非常有帮助。常用的APK反编译工具有Apktool、JADX等。使用这些工具可以将APK包中的资源文件提取出来,并尝试还原其编译后的代码,虽然可能无法完全还原,但足以用于逆向工程和安全分析。 知识点二:修改APK中的脚本文件 在教程中,提到了修改com.mh.dfxyassets目录下script.zip压缩包内的Update.GameUpdate文件。这通常涉及到对APK中特定文件的编辑,这些文件往往包含了应用程序的脚本逻辑。Update.GameUpdate文件可能是一个脚本文件,它控制了游戏的更新逻辑。通过修改这个文件,可能可以改变游戏更新检查的方式、版本信息或者更新流程等。这对于开发者而言,是在对应用程序进行定制化修改和测试时非常有用的一种技能。 知识点三:加密与解密的基本概念 在描述中虽然没有详细展开,但标题提到了“加密解密”,这意味着逍遥西游客户端可能使用了某种加密机制来保护其数据和代码安全。在软件开发中,加密是将数据转换成密文,使之在未授权的情况下无法被读取;解密则是将密文还原成明文,使其可以被正确理解和使用。加密解密是信息安全领域的基础知识点,广泛应用于软件保护、数据存储、网络安全和通信安全等方面。 知识点四:使用Update.GameUpdate文件进行解密 教程提到了先打开Update.GameUpdate文件来解密。这可能意味着该文件中包含了用于更新数据的加密信息。解密这个文件可以揭露游戏更新的细节,比如更新内容、更新机制等。这一步骤是整个加密解密教程中的核心部分,对于理解应用程序的更新逻辑和可能的安全机制至关重要。 知识点五:软件逆向工程工具的使用 教程中并没有明确提及逆向工程工具的使用,但根据教程内容,不难推测出逆向工程工具在这一过程中扮演的角色。逆向工程是指通过分析软件的可执行文件,获取其源代码或者设计思路的过程。在安全研究、漏洞分析、软件兼容性改进等多个领域都有重要应用。逍遥西游的加密解密工具可能包含了逆向工程所需的调试器、反汇编器、反编译器等工具集,这些工具可以帮助开发者深入了解软件的工作原理。 知识点六:资源文件管理 APK包中的资源文件管理是Android开发的重要知识点。在逍遥西游客户端中,可能包含了各种资源文件,如图片、音频、视频以及文本文件等。了解如何管理和修改这些资源文件对于定制化应用或者进行游戏本地化等都是很有帮助的。在进行加密解密工作时,可能需要对这些资源文件进行解包和重新打包操作。 以上知识点紧密围绕着逍遥西游客户端的加密解密过程,涵盖了从APK反编译、脚本修改、加密解密原理到逆向工程工具的使用等多个方面,为有兴趣深入研究Android应用安全和逆向工程的开发者提供了宝贵的学习资源。

相关推荐

filetype
资源下载链接为: https://pan.quark.cn/s/1bfadf00ae14 “STC单片机电压测量”是一个以STC系列单片机为基础的电压检测应用案例,它涵盖了硬件电路设计、软件编程以及数据处理等核心知识点。STC单片机凭借其低功耗、高性价比和丰富的I/O接口,在电子工程领域得到了广泛应用。 STC是Specialized Technology Corporation的缩写,该公司的单片机基于8051内核,具备内部振荡器、高速运算能力、ISP(在系统编程)和IAP(在应用编程)功能,非常适合用于各种嵌入式控制系统。 在源代码方面,“浅雪”风格的代码通常简洁易懂,非常适合初学者学习。其中,“main.c”文件是程序的入口,包含了电压测量的核心逻辑;“STARTUP.A51”是启动代码,负责初始化单片机的硬件环境;“电压测量_uvopt.bak”和“电压测量_uvproj.bak”可能是Keil编译器的配置文件备份,用于设置编译选项和项目配置。 对于3S锂电池电压测量,3S锂电池由三节锂离子电池串联而成,标称电压为11.1V。测量时需要考虑电池的串联特性,通过分压电路将高电压转换为单片机可接受的范围,并实时监控,防止过充或过放,以确保电池的安全和寿命。 在电压测量电路设计中,“电压测量.lnp”文件可能包含电路布局信息,而“.hex”文件是编译后的机器码,用于烧录到单片机中。电路中通常会使用ADC(模拟数字转换器)将模拟电压信号转换为数字信号供单片机处理。 在软件编程方面,“StringData.h”文件可能包含程序中使用的字符串常量和数据结构定义。处理电压数据时,可能涉及浮点数运算,需要了解STC单片机对浮点数的支持情况,以及如何高效地存储和显示电压值。 用户界面方面,“电压测量.uvgui.kidd”可能是用户界面的配置文件,用于显示测量结果。在嵌入式系统中,用
逐梦科技网络
  • 粉丝: 301
上传资源 快速赚钱